Military chief says he will respect election

RANGOON: -- Defence Services Commander-in-Chief Senior General Min Aung Hlaing has told the BBC that he will respect any fair election results.

"I believe the election will be free and fair," Min Aung Hlaing told the BBC. "That is our true wish. We are committed to helping make that happen anyway we can. When the election commission announces the result we have to respect it. Because it will have been democratically done.
